      Isleen-

      You may be thinking of my other mod "Empyrean Warpaints - Custom Series" (@ http://www.nexusmods.com/skyrim/mods/62639/) that has all the eyeliners and stuff, and is only meant for the female face.

      Lordburnch is actually using my original mod that has a bunch of warpaints specifically for males (as well as females), and includes generally bigger and bolder face paints such as the ones he used here.

      It is called "Empyrean Warpaints in HD" @ http://www.nexusmods.com/skyrim/mods/61332/

      This one has lipsticks, too, but no eyeliners.
